More about the PRIDE program PRIDE is a program with informational seminars engaging students in fun activities related to their major. Through friendship building and community involvement, PRIDE strives to see their active students succeed. While participating in the informational seminars PRIDE students are educated with the latest things that are going on in their major. Questions like, how you can apply a degree in computer science or math in the real world are answered along with any interests that pertain to the group. PRIDE
takes the time to let you know how to apply your degree of choice in everyday life. They support their students academically by sharing helpful tips on
